Hi Patrick,
I would like to suggest another way of iterating on the pids;
if you prefer to keep what you have, let me know and I will apply your
patch.
My suggestion is to follow the kind of enumeration that we have in
data structures such as lib/libc/misc/ListSimple.H through the
method next(), which takes a opaque pointer as an argument and returns
the "next" element in the list.
For you enumaration, this would mean to have a method
SysStatus getNextPID(void* &curr, pid_t &pid).
If the method is called with curr == NULL, the implementation
will return the first pid, and it will also update curr to store
the "restart node" that your implementation searches for.
The client of getNextPID can't look at curr; it will just pass
it along on its next call when it wants to advance in the enumeration.
What do you think?
